The first half of 2026 brought a string of high-profile K-pop comebacks and reunions, from IOI's 10th-anniversary chart return to BIGBANG's 20th-debut world tour.

The first half of 2026 kept K-pop moving fast. IOI, Wanna One, BIGBANG, SECRET, and BTS all made noise — some returning after years, some after more than a decade.
IOI marked their 10th debut anniversary with a full reunion, though not quite full: 9 of the original 11 members participated, with Joo Kyulkyung and Kang Mina sitting out. Gapjagi, their new single, hit No. 1 on music charts and music broadcast rankings.
Wanna One officially announced their reunion in January 2026 and resumed activities through the Mnet Plus reality program Wanna One Go. Nine members joined. Kang Daniel is currently serving in the military, and Lai Guanlin (라이관린) is working as a film director in China. Their first live stage since reuniting is set for KCON LA this summer.
BIGBANG is celebrating their 20th debut anniversary with full-group activities and a large-scale world tour under YG Entertainment. They recently performed at the Coachella Valley Music and Arts Festival in Los Angeles. The tour kicks off at Goyang Sports Complex in August 2026.
BTS also made a comeback in the first half of the year, reaffirming their standing in the industry.
SECRET announced a reunion after 12 years with a twist. The group is adding new member Yebin alongside returning members Jeon Hyosung and Jung Hana, operating as a three-member act.
The industry is calling it "Back to 2010" season, and the numbers back that up.
